Understanding Depression

Many think depression just means being sad, but it is a lot more complicated. It changes feelings, sparks difficult thoughts, and even messes with physical health. When clinical depression is present, it gets in the way of everyday duties, friendships, work duties, and how life feels overall.

These are some typical signs:

  • A heavy sense of sadness or feeling empty day after day

  • Not caring about things that used to bring joy

  • Trouble sleeping or sleeping way too much

  • Eating changes that lead to weight loss or gain

  • Ongoing exhaustion and no drive

  • Thoughts that swing to hopelessness, guilt, or feeling worthless

  • Finding it hard to think, focus, or remember

  • Thoughts about hurting oneself or making a plan to do so

Without the right help, these signs can go from slight to intense, lasting weeks, months, or even longer.

Treatment Options for Depression in Fresno

When it’s time to tackle depression, Fresno offers a menu of proven therapies, each designed to fit individual strengths and challenges.

1. Therapy and Counseling

  •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T): Spot and challenge the negative thoughts that bring you down.

  •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T): Learn mindfulness, control emotions, and ride through distress without getting stuck.

  • Interpersonal Therapy (IPT): Fix key relationships and boost the social skills that depression can cloud.

  • Group Therapy: Share your story, hear others, and gain strength from the fact that you’re never alone.

2. Medication Management

When the mood is hard to lift, your psychiatrist might suggest an antidepressant. Options usually include SSRIs, SNRIs, or atypical antidepressants. These help level out the brain chemicals that control how we feel. Taking medicine works best when paired with therapy, giving your brain the extra boost it may need.

3. Holistic Approaches

Bringing the body and mind together is another way to move forward:

  • Focus on calming your mind through yoga, meditation, and mindfulness.

  • Eat right and stay active with nutrition counseling and exercise groups.

  • Find your expression in art or music therapy.

  • Manage stress through tried-and-true techniques.

4. Intensive Outpatient Programs (IOP) and Residential Care

For deeper lows, IOP or a stay in a residential center can help. These structured programs offer daily therapy, small group sessions, and close medical supervision.
